Transaction e859bf11353ecb3217a3745ef74280b02ad4dac5d03662740281f68efca42128
1 Input
2 Outputs
- e859bf11353ecb3217a3745ef74280b02ad4dac5d03662740281f68efca42128:0
- e859bf11353ecb3217a3745ef74280b02ad4dac5d03662740281f68efca42128:1
value 5570523
address 1DbdwXoXWeoDWg3GyPnTnzykx5gevLdCSs
value 1230994292
address 1SurBqvoK1KK55Zs9pqHVWejY75PVeb7F